Top Links
- Announcing Windows Community Toolkit v7.0 (Michael A. Hawker)
- Visual Studio 2019 version 16.9.2 Release Notes (Microsoft Docs)
- Leverage Microsoft Graph in Electron Applications using Microsoft Graph Toolkit! (Amrutha Srinivasan)
- Service to service invocation with Dapr .NET SDK (Laurent Kempe)
- C# 10 — 3 Candidate Features That Could Make the Final Cut (Matthew MacDonald)
Web & Cloud Development
- Introducing Auth0’s Next.js SDK (Adam McGrath)
- Blazorise v0.9.3 – patch 1 release notes (Mladen Macanovic)
- How to Send an SMS with Node.js (Ashley Boucher)
- Level Up: Creative coding with p5.js – part 1 (Ben Popper & Jiwon Shin)
- How to Implement a Queue in JavaScript (Dmitri Pavlutin)
- WebStorm 2020.3.3 Is Available (Ekaterina Ryabukha)
- Next 10 years of Node.js — Understanding the needs of the Node.js constituencies (Node.js Team)
- Want secure access to (cloud) services from your Kubernetes-based app? GKE Workload Identity is the answer. (Richard Seroter)
- How To Use Ngx-slider With A Different Type Of Styles In Angular (Satheesh Elumalai)
- Azure Workbooks – Save as PDF (Print) (Shikha Jain)
- Ghost 4.0 Released (Ben Moss)
- The authentication pyramid (Damien Bowden)
XAML, UWP & Xamarin
- I updated a Xamarin Forms project to Maui (Brad Dean)
- Windows Community Toolkit Gets .NET Standard MVVM Library (David Ramel)
- Adventures in ARKit – respond to touch (David Britch)
Visual Studio & .NET
- Survey Finds Slow EF Core Adoption, Surprising Dev Team (David Ramel)
- Python in Visual Studio Code – March 2021 Release (Luciana Abud)
- How to Compile C/C++ Code in VS Code (Windows) (Sameer Bairwa)
- Create A Zip File With .NET 5 (Khalid Abuhakmeh)
- Previewing .NET 6 – Exploring Improvements (Hannes Du Preez)
- Strings Contain Empty Strings (Steve Fenton)
Design, Methodology & Testing
- Code Review and DevOps (Grant Fritchey)
- The One Thing Every Successful Person Has In Common: Consistency (Amy Rigby)
- Using GitHub code scanning and CodeQL to detect traces of Solorigate and other backdoors (Bas van Schaik)
- CUPID – the back story (Daniel Terhorst-North)
- Improving large monorepo performance on GitHub (Scott Arbeit)
- Are You a Self-Limiting Designer? (Scott Berkun)
- Microservices Architecture Pattern (Subodh Sohoni)
- The Layers in the Test Automation Journey (Rajini Padmanaban)
Mobile, IoT & Game Development
- The Case of the Last T: A behind the scenes look at how we decided to capitalize the T in Azure.IoT (Jon Gallant)
Podcasts, Screencasts & Videos
- Developer Tea – Geoff Schmidt, CEO and Co-founder of Apollo GraphQL, Part Two (Jonathan Cutrell)
- RunAs Radio – Migrating to Azure SQL with Anna Hoffman (Richard Campbell & Greg Hughes)
- On Prem To The Cloud: Everything As Code (Episode 4) | The DevOps Lab (Abel Wang & Steven Murawski)
- Xamarin Community Toolkit – Forget Time Zones with DateTimeOffsetConverter | The Xamarin Show (Gerald Versluis & Mark Allibone)
- JSJ 475: DevOps for the JavaScript Developer (Aimee Knight, AJ O’Neal & Dan Shappir)
- Working Code Podcast – Episode 014: Zen And The Art Of Pull Requests (Ben Nadel)
- Asp.Net Monsters #204 – Output Formatters in ASP.NET Core (Simon Timms, James Chambers & David Paquette)
- Adventures in .NET 060: Pursuing Developer Certifications (Caleb Wells, Shawn Clabough & Wai Liu)
- Microsoft Cloud Show Episode 400 | Happy Birthday Cloud Show (Andrew Connell & Chris Johnson)
- Complete Developer Podcast – Metacoding: Coding Code Analyzers (BJ Burns & Will Gant)
- Quantum Questions with Dr. Sarah Kaiser | CodeStories (Christina Warren)
- The CSS Podcast 034: Overflow (Una Kravets & Adam Argyle)
- FreeCodeSession – Episode 247 (Jason Bock)
- Microsoft 365 Dev Podcast – Microsoft Graph Toolkit mgt-get component with Sebastien Levert (Jeremy Thake & Paul Schaeflein)
- 8 Bits with B Dougie! (Brandon Minnick & Chloe Condon)
- Time Travel Debugging by Ozcode (with narration) (Ozcode)
- Using Markdown to Optimize your GitHub Project Recap | Learn with Dr G (Sarah Guthals, PhD)
- Software Engineering Radio Episode 451: Luke Kysow on Service Mesh (Priyanka Raghavan)
- On Prem To the Cloud: Everything As Code (Ep 4) (Steven Murawski)
Community & Events
- Hello World Now Available Outside of North America (Shawn Wildermuth)
- A Pandemic By Any Other Name (Zach Leatherman)
- A warmer world will hurt this group more than any other (Bill Gates)
- Learn How Developers Think: Get the Latest “Meet the Developers” Ebook (DeveloperMedia)
- Women In Teams Collaborate, Share, Educate (Jeffrey Raymond Kitt)
Database
- SQL SERVER – List Expensive Queries – Updated March 2021 (Pinal Dave)
- The T-SQL DELETE statement (John Miner)
- SQL, JSON, and Domain Objects (Andrew MacMurray)
- Data Structures & Full-Text Search Indexing in Couchbase (Tyler Mitchell)
SharePoint & MS Teams
- Microsoft Lists – An Evolution of SharePoint Lists (Michael Reinders)
- CLI for Microsoft 365 v3.7 (Waldek Mastykarz)
PowerShell
- How To Hide SharePoint List Using PnP PowerShell (Ramesh Kumar)
More Link Collections
- The Morning Brew #3192 (Chris Alcock)
- .NET App Developer Links – 2021-03-17 (Dan Rigby)
The Geek Shelf
C# 9 and .NET 5 – Modern Cross-Platform Development: Build intelligent apps, websites, and services with Blazor, ASP.NET Core, and Entity Framework Core using Visual Studio Code, 5th Ed (Mark J. Price) – Referral Link